Best Pakistani TV Shows Everybody is Talking About this Week

Pakistani TV Shows

Pakistan has a hot television business with various dramas with huge audiences and online discussions that continue without stopping. The weekly rankings have indicated clearly that the diversity of storytelling remains a key factor that keeps the audience’s appetites going. Heavy on romance, the leading is the 15 million views of Meri Zindagi Hai Tu, closely behind it is the 14 million views of Sanwal Yar Piya, which has been popular with the fans, owing to its emotional appeal. Such titles as GhulamBadshahSundari and Muamma are also gradually becoming more and more popular, combining drama with mystery.

What is behind the Weekly Buzz?

This popularity spurt explains why Top Pakistani TV Shows remain a trend on the platforms. The audience is moving towards intense acting, characters that people can relate to and well-crafted plots. Dramas like Aik Aur Pakeeza, Masoom, and Kafeel are attracting a regular viewer, and Faslay, Sharpasand, and Iblees are also included in the list with regular digital presence. On-demand availability and viral videos have also contributed to the increased distribution, and the Top Pakistani TV Shows are taken over by the conversation outside the television. With the number of views continuously increasing, Top Pakistani TV Shows are demonstrating that interesting stories are the core of the entertainment sector in Pakistan.
